All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/oh/ohfi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Connie Cotterill Schumaker Schumaker4@aol.com September 14, 2004, 10:29 pm microfilm Meigs County Telegraph Pomeroy, Ohio Tuesday, March 25, 1856 EFFECTS OF DRUNKENNESS In Coalport, on Friday last, two men, an Englishman and Irishman, named Watson and O’Neil, while their brains were fired with strong drink, got into a fight. Watson getting the upper-hand of O’Neil kicked him several times in the abdomen from the effects of which the latter died the next day. Watson fled and has not since been heard off. All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/oh/ohfi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Connie Cotterill Schumaker Schumaker4@aol.com September 15, 2004, 12:01 am microfilm Meigs County Telegraph Pomeroy, Ohio Tuesday, April 1, 1856 AFFRAY IN HARRISONVILLE We learn from a gentleman who came through the above place on Saturday last, that an affray occurred there that day between two men named Conde and Criss. It appears that a dispute arose between them in regard to the ownership of certain lands upon which Criss was building a fence, a quarrel ensured, which resulted in Conde’s striking Criss on the head with a club, injuring him severely. It is reported to-day (Monday) that Criss died from the effects of the blow. FIRE The cry of fire on last Sunday evening caused not a little alarm among many who perhaps were not thinking of their danger from this devouring element. It was fortunately, however, of short duration this time, having only burned the window curtain and sash in the house of Mr. Mayhugh, before it was extinguished.
